Does exactly what I need it to do!
It was time for my young chickens to learn what it’s like to be outside, after spending their first several weeks of life inside the warm brooder. I was on the hunt for a quick fix that can easily be stowed away and this was it. It went together quickly with zip ties; however they were terribly weak and several broke, so we used our own stash. We didn’t use the ‘roost bar’ and that is definitely not designed for chickens. It took about 10 minutes for us to set up and carry outside. The chicks definitely loved being out there, learning to scratch and peck as chickens do. This isn’t predator safe and it’s not meant to keep chickens/animals in overnight, but definitely does its job in letting them be safely outside while I’m out there. The rain cover worked perfectly too, since it started raining about an hour after they went in… they learned quickly too that there is cover to huddle under. I like the multiple doors as well, it gives you options on putting animals in and taking them out. Granted, we are only using one right now, but options are good! I do recommend closing off those that you aren’t using with a zip tie as well, so it doesn’t accidentally come open.

Chicken run assembly
It is made of the same material as a large dog crate. Assembly was not as difficult as some commented on. It comes as three four-part panels (end, middle, end) and two side end panels and two support bars. Each panel has "clips" where another is attached to it. There are plenty of zip ties and the instructions indicate where to put them. "S" carabiners (5) are for locking the doors. There are u shaped stakes to anchor it to the ground and the tarp. The side end panels are clipped to each end using zip ties to secure in place, then connect the end panels to the middle panel accordingly. This is where I had a little trouble as several clips were very tight. I show a picture (pic 1) of my plyers with material to keep from scratching the wire as I am squeezing hard to get a wire to slide into the clip. After slightly bending the wire (pic 2) I moved my material/plyers closer to the clip to gently squeeze the wire into the clip. The doors have a gravity lock and the "S" clip keeps the lock from being slid upward, to a point. The hooks need to be fatter as the lock can still be slid upward and all your critters can come on out to play! I was in church and received a text eight of my nine hens were out loose in the yard. Thankfully the hawks weren't around and they all were coaxed back into the run with grains. Shew! I have used some Velcro (non abrasive) to keep the doors secured while I find another solution. My last picture is of the whole set up. I wanted something that would not be an eye sore and I found it. However, it is so camouflaged sometimes I think the hens are out again! lol. We may put something to make it show up a little because we do not want hawks to think the hens are free as well! That may be in the future. The hens love the two support bars going across the middle. I love the door on the roof for easy access to toss in goodies. I have one back door butted up against the opening to a wire tunnel which leads to the main coop. I hope to order another one of these, remove two doors (maybe), and connect them at at 90 degree angle for more run space. To keep the weed eater from damaging it I have placed it on wide fence boards and will probably use 14" zip ties to attach the run to the boards vs the stakes provided into the ground. This will also keep them from digging out (sandy soil), or someone from digging in, whatever the case may be. I am very pleased with this item.
